Most of us now realize the essential role bees and other pollinators play in our gardens, fields and nature in general, but how do we feel about the less “attractive” insects? Would or would you not grab a tissue and squish that black beetle you spot hiding behind your washer? And what about silverfish or cockroaches scampering across the floor when you switch on a kitchen light?
Reading German entomologist, science reporter and filmmaker Frank Nischk’s book (translated by Jane Billinghurst) Of Cockroaches and Crickets: Learning to Love Creatures That Skitter and Jump might just convince you to catch and release, instead of dispatch, the next insect you discover thanks to his insights into the interconnected roles insects play in our world. To put it simply: fewer insects, fewer plant species, fewer birds, fewer amphibians, fewer animals who feed on these and ultimately fewer diverse food and medicinal resources for humans.
Nischk was working on his thesis in biology at the University of Cologne in 1993 when he was hired by esteemed zoologist Martin Dambach as a research assistant. Having recently returned from a brief stint of studying hummingbirds in Colombia’s tropics, Nischk was happy to earn some money but less than pleased to discover that his new research subject was the lowly German cockroach, Blattella germanica — as he says, “one of the least loved animals in the world.”

This insect will survive as long as it has a modest amount of heat, cracks in which to hide and food. About the latter they are not choosy; anything will do, including human hair, fabric and shoe polish. Possibly the most disturbing thing about the cockroach is that it hides in its own excrement. That said, Nischk informs us that the German cockroach is fairly harmless compared to ticks and fleas, but have become a sign of poor hygiene and are very unwelcome in any kitchen.
The main reason for cockroaches being found around the world — including in submarines, airplanes, televisions and microwave ovens, among countless other places — is that one pair of cockroaches can produce 100,000 offspring in a year. “Its tough, flat body, which fits into the tiniest of cracks, makes it a perfect stowaway.”
Nischk’s cockroach research was part of Bayer’s goal to identify the pheromone so irresistible to cockroaches that they would be lured to a baited trap and then exterminated. However, the lowly cockroach has staying power. With 20,000 species in the world and the ability to survive radiation 10 times better than humans, the insect is likely to be one of the last survivors.
Nischk reports that cockroaches play a role as decomposers and converting dead life forms into nutrients that sustain new life. They are a food source for birds, reptiles and insect-eating mammals. Through his research into insect species found in some of the world’s most remote areas, he relates how these creatures have adapted to their often-challenging environments and how their survival assists the survival of many other plant and animal species.
The rainforest’s complex food web has been disrupted by human development, but Nischk also contends that many species are at risk throughout the world. “We are in the middle of an enormous wave of extinction across almost every animal class… An estimated half a million to a million species are facing extinction. The main reasons are agriculture, deforestation, fisheries, hunting, and climate change.”

Nischk says it’s impossible to completely reverse this pattern but by preserving biodiversity, there is hope. In Yungilla, a small community close to Ecuador’s capital, Quito, the residents have recognized eco-tourism as an easier way to make money than farming. They have allowed the surrounding landscape to slowly return to forest and encourage the continuing survival of Andean short-faced or spectacled bears and other wildlife that attract tourists to their community.
Nischk ends Of Cockroaches and Crickets with this and a few other positive examples of humans working to protect animal species. “Protecting, restoring and connecting habitats seems to me the only way we can stop the catastrophic mass extinction of species on our planet,” he writes.
Well-written and entertaining, Of Cockroaches and Crickets will increase your respect for the creatures inhabiting the cracks in your house.
